Rest Easy: Skills to Help Fall & Stay Asleep
April 30, 2025 at 7 p.m. (live)
May 1, 2025 at 2 p.m. (recorded)
Presented by Jilian DeTiberiis
In this FREE webinar, “Rest Easy: Skills to Help Fall & Stay Asleep,” we’ll explore effective strategies to improve sleep for both children and adults. You’ll learn how to identify common sleep challenges in yourself, your children, or those you work with, and discover a variety of methods to address these issues. We’ll also focus on practical approaches using ABA procedures to help implement lasting solutions. Whether you’re struggling with sleep personally or looking for ways to support others, this session will provide you with the tools to make a real impact and rest easier.

Jilian Planer DeTiberiis earned her undergraduate degree in Psychology at Rowan University and her master’s degree at Caldwell University in Applied Behavior Analysis. While attending Caldwell University, she completed her thesis, “Evaluating Tasks within a High-Probability Request Sequence with Children with Autism.” Upon completion of her degree at Caldwell University, she became a Board Certified Behavior Analyst. She also completed a teacher certification program and is a certified teacher in elementary K – 5 and special education. Prior to joining Graham Behavior Services, Jilian worked as a special education teacher in an autism program in a public school and also has experience working in a private school for individuals with autism. She also worked at a private agency as the Clinical and Executive Director. Jilian is the resident sleep expert at GBS! She has worked in the area of sleeping skills for multiple years, has received specialized training from FTF Consulting, and is a Certified Sleep Science Coach. Jilian has presented on a variety of topics at Autism NJ and NJABA, including sleep, trauma-informed care, social skills, and others.
